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Norfolk island pine | Pearson s Pericote |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Coniferophyta (Conifers)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Pinopsida (Conifers)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Pinales (Pines & Allies)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Araucariaceae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Araucaria | Andalgalomys |
| Species | Araucaria heterophylla | Andalgalomys pearsoni |
